Biography of Princess Diana

The princess’ full name is Diana Frances Spencer. She was born on July 1, 1961. Diana was born in a house not a hospital, and the house was called Park house. Her family had rented it from the Royal Family Estate for many years. Diana had two sisters, Sarah and Jane. She also had a younger brother, Charles. Occasionally as a child Diana would play with Prince Edward and Prince Andrew. When she was only six years old Diana’s mother left her father, however the two did not get a divorce until 1969 when Diana was only eight years old. Diana’s father Earl Spencer received custody of all three children. Shortly after the divorce, Diana's mother remarried a man named Peter Shand. In 1975, her father had become the eighth Earl Spencer. This made Diana’s proper name Lady Diana Spencer. Due to this Change Diana and her siblings moved to Anthrop, the Spencer family estate in northern Hampton.
